This event is open to Post-Docs and Graduate Students only.

The goal of the session is to acquaint you with common terminology currently in use in higher education. From the flipped classroom, to inquiry-based learning, to inclusive teaching, to active learning, to metacognition, to formative and summative assessment, to student evaluations of teaching (SET), and more, we plan to work through a glossary of 'buzzwords' with you. These can be used to inform your teaching practice as well as your teaching statements (commonly required in academic job applications).
